However, if the wax is excessive and clogging your ear, you may want to remove some to feel more comfortable. Therefore, it's good to have some wax in your ears. When you chew and move your jaw, you help move old earwax out. Mehdizadeh says that although many people think earwax is bad, it's actually protective. Earwax is like a filter for your ears, keeping out harmful things like dirt and dust, and trapping them so they don’t go deep inside. The risks certainly outweigh the potential benefits, and safer methods should be used to remove earwax instead. Additionally, the candle could push the natural ear wax even deeper into the ear canal. "Irritation such as heat or manipulation of a foreign object in the ear canal such as a candle can cause potential injury," Mehdizadeh says. The hot wax can cause burn injuries to the ear and face and damage the ear canal. This is because the ear canal is a highly sensitive area with a paper-thin membrane. Ear getting clogged with candle wax, resulting in some hearing loss.There are multiple risks involved with ear candling, Mehdizadeh says. In addition, the researchers surveyed 122 otolaryngologists and identified 21 ear injuries resulting from ear candling. The results showed that no earwax was removed from any ear. In fact, a 1996 study evaluated the efficacy of candling on eight ears. And if you do end up with what looks to be removed ear wax from candling, it's likely just melted candle wax. Mehdizadeh says research has shown that the vacuum effect produced is not enough to extract wax. Mehdizadeh says it is not safe, and it's not even effective at removing wax.
